The information on this page refers to SOAP version 2, which added this function. SOAP version 1 does not include this function. |
The DeactivateLicense function confirms that a request to remove a license from a host was successful. This function requires an activation key and a HostID. Examples of a request and response for DeactivateLicense are given below
Note that the response for DeactivateLicense will contain a license string if successful or an error message if unsuccessful. See Return Codes for more information about error messages.
Example request
<soapenv:Envelope xmlns:xsi="http://www.w3.org/2001/XMLSchema-instance" xmlns:xsd="http://www.w3.org/2001/XMLSchema" xmlns:soapenv="http://schemas.xmlsoap.org/soap/envelope/" xmlns:ns="https://license.x-formation.com/soap/type/enduser/version/2"> <soapenv:Header/> <soapenv:Body> <ns:DeactivateLicense soapenv:encodingStyle="http://schemas.xmlsoap.org/soap/encoding/"> <activationKey xsi:type="xsd:string">9RTV8-YX2P3-E53Q8-1OAB6</activationKey> <hostid xsi:type="xsd:string">not_specified</hostid> </ns:DeactivateLicense> </soapenv:Body> </soapenv:Envelope>
Example response
<SOAP-ENV:Envelope SOAP-ENV:encodingStyle="http://schemas.xmlsoap.org/soap/encoding/" xmlns:SOAP-ENV="http://schemas.xmlsoap.org/soap/envelope/" xmlns:ns1="https://license.x-formation.com/soap/type/enduser/version/2" xmlns:xsd="http://www.w3.org/2001/XMLSchema" xmlns:xsi="http://www.w3.org/2001/XMLSchema-instance" xmlns:SOAP-ENC="http://schemas.xmlsoap.org/soap/encoding/"> <SOAP-ENV:Body> <ns1:DeactivateLicenseResponse> <return xsi:type="ns1:Soap_Response"> <result_code xsi:type="xsd:int">0</result_code> <result_string xsi:nil="true"/> </return> </ns1:DeactivateLicenseResponse> </SOAP-ENV:Body> </SOAP-ENV:Envelope>
